The Importance of Contacting a Personal Injury Lawyer for Long-Term Disability Claims in Halifax, Nova Scotia

Dealing with a long-term disability claim can be an overwhelming and complex process. Long-Term Disability (LTD) insurance is designed to provide income replacement for individuals who are unable to work due to injury or illness for an extended period. However, insurance companies often make it difficult for claimants to access the benefits they are entitled to, leading to denials and financial hardship for those in need. If you find yourself struggling with a long-term disability claim in Halifax, Nova Scotia, it is essential to seek the help of a knowledgeable personal injury lawyer.   1. Proving Disability

To access long-term disability benefits, the insurer requires substantial evidence of disability [1][2]. This process often involves providing medical records and reports from doctors and specialists. A personal injury lawyer can guide you in gathering and submitting all the necessary evidence within the correct time frames to strengthen your claim.

  1. Efficiently Handling the Transition from Short-Term to Long-Term Disability

The transition from Short-Term Disability (STD) to Long-Term Disability (LTD) can be a critical juncture where insurers are more likely to deny claims. Even if you have documentation from your physician stating that you are disabled from all occupations, the insurance company may still dispute your disability and entitlement to LTD benefits [1]. A personal injury lawyer can help ensure a smooth transition and increase your chances of receiving the benefits you deserve.
